About Robert G. Bowman
Robert G. Bowman is a scholar working on Finance, Accounting, Strategy and Management, Economics and Econometrics and General Economics, Econometrics and Finance, having authored 37 papers that have together received 1.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Financial Markets and Investment Strategies (10 papers), Corporate Finance and Governance (10 papers), Financial Reporting and Valuation Research (8 papers), Auditing, Earnings Management, Governance (7 papers), Market Dynamics and Volatility (5 papers), Capital Investment and Risk Analysis (3 papers), Private Equity and Venture Capital (3 papers) and Monetary Policy and Economic Impact (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Accounting (581 citations), Finance (504 citations), Strategy and Management (322 citations), Catalysis (89 citations) and Economics and Econometrics (259 citations). Robert G. Bowman has collaborated with scholars based in New Zealand, United States and Australia. Frequent co-authors include Robert L. Burwell, David Iverson, David L. Anderson, Byung S. Min, Fred Basolo, Ryuichi Nakamura, Michael G. Blennerhassett, Glen E. Woolfenden, Michael Gochfeld and Joanna Burger. Their work appears in journals such as The Journal of Finance, Journal of the American Chemical Society, Journal of Catalysis, Pacific-Basin Finance Journal and Financial Accountability and Management.
